Key Factors to Consider When Choosing a Cot
Before diving into the specifics of the best cots for newborns cots, it's crucial to comprehend what functions make a cot suitable for your baby. Here are some key elements to think about:
Safety Standards
Make sure that the cot adheres to security policies and standards in your region. Look for certifications that indicate the cot has actually gone through rigorous screening for security.
Material
The product of the cot can considerably impact its resilience. Typical products consist of solid wood, metal, and composite products.
Adjustable Mattress Height
Cots with adjustable bed mattress height allow you to reduce the mattress as your baby grows and begins to pull themselves up, making it much safer for young children.
Size
Consider the size of the cot in relation to your nursery. Guarantee it fits conveniently without overcrowding the space.
Alleviate of Conversion
Many contemporary cots can convert into toddler beds or daybeds. This feature can extend the life of the cot and provide worth.

Frequently asked questions1. What age should my baby shift from a cot?
The majority of kids transition from a cot to a bed between 2-3 years of age, but this can vary based upon the kid's preparedness and developmental turning points.
2. How do I ensure the cot is safe?
Constantly look for security accreditations and guarantee that there are no loose parts or sharp edges. The mattress needs to fit snugly within the cot without spaces.
3. Can I utilize a mattress from a different cot?
It is not recommended to use a mattress from another cot unless it fits safely and adheres to security requirements. A bed mattress that is too little can create gaps, posing a possible threat.
4. How often should I inspect the cot?
Inspect the cot frequently for wear and tear, loose screws, or any prospective security issues, particularly as your baby grows.
5. Is it essential to get a convertible crib?
While not required, convertible cribs offer longevity and can be an economical option in the long run as they can adjust to your child's altering needs.
